matthunz avatar matthunz commented on May 13, 2024

Something like https://doc.rust-lang.org/std/iter/fn.from_fn.html

Basically it would just exist to handle cases where you do want your view inside a closure. Then we could write v_stack(text("Hello world!")) and v_stack(view::from_fn(|| text("Hello world!")))

dzhou121 avatar dzhou121 commented on May 13, 2024

Got it thanks for clarifying.

The view has to be always inside a closure though because the child's id needs to be created based on the parent's id.
